Start with Licensing and Player Protection
A valid gambling licence is the first sign that an operator is accountable to an external authority. Licensed casinos are generally expected to follow rules covering fair play, identity checks, responsible gambling, advertising, and the handling of customer funds. The licence number should be visible on the website and verifiable through the regulator’s official database.
Security matters just as much. Look for encrypted connections, clear privacy policies, and two-factor authentication where available. A serious operator should explain how personal information is collected, stored, and shared. It should also offer tools that help players manage their activity, including deposit limits, session reminders, cooling-off periods, and self-exclusion.
Compare Games, Software, and Fairness
Game quality is not measured by the size of a lobby alone. A balanced casino combines popular slots with table games, live dealer titles, jackpots, and suitable mobile versions. Recognised software studios are often preferred because their games are tested by independent organisations and supported across multiple devices.
| Feature | What to Check | Why It Matters |
|---|---|---|
| Game selection | Slots, roulette, blackjack, live casino | Provides variety for different playing styles |
| Fairness information | RNG testing and return-to-player details | Improves transparency before play begins |
| Mobile performance | Responsive design and stable loading | Allows convenient play on phones and tablets |
| Game rules | Clear instructions and betting limits | Helps players understand risks and mechanics |
Return to player figures can help compare similar games, although they describe long-term statistical expectations rather than guaranteed results. Volatility is equally relevant: high-volatility games may offer larger prizes but can produce longer periods without significant wins.
Read Bonus Conditions Before Accepting
A welcome offer may look generous until its conditions are examined. Wagering requirements, maximum bet limits, eligible games, expiry dates, and withdrawal restrictions can significantly change the real value of a promotion. Some bonuses also require a minimum deposit or exclude certain payment methods.
- Check the wagering requirement and the funds to which it applies.
- Confirm whether a maximum stake applies while the bonus is active.
- Review the permitted games and their contribution percentages.
- Find the deadline for completing the promotion.
- Check whether winnings are capped or subject to verification.
Cashback, reload bonuses, free spins, and loyalty schemes may be more useful than a large first-deposit offer for regular players. However, no reward should influence a decision to gamble beyond a personal budget.
Evaluate Banking Speed and Support
Payment options should match the player’s location and preferences. Bank cards, bank transfers, e-wallets, and selected digital payment services may all be available, but processing times and fees can differ. Deposit confirmation is often immediate, while withdrawals may involve internal checks before approval.
Before making a deposit, review the minimum and maximum limits, withdrawal times, currency support, and any charges. A platform that explains its cashier process clearly is usually easier to manage than one that leaves important information hidden in separate help pages.
Customer support is another useful quality indicator. Live chat is generally the fastest route for urgent questions, while email can be suitable for detailed account issues. Test whether agents provide direct, consistent answers about verification, promotions, and withdrawals.
Build a Safer Playing Routine
Even a well-regulated casino cannot remove the financial risk of gambling. Set a spending limit before opening a session and treat deposits as entertainment costs, not as a way to solve money problems. Avoid chasing losses, borrowing funds, or increasing stakes simply because a previous session went badly.
A short checklist can help maintain perspective:
- Decide on a fixed budget and time limit.
- Keep gambling separate from essential household spending.
- Take regular breaks during longer sessions.
- Use account controls whenever play feels difficult to manage.
- Seek professional support if gambling starts affecting work, relationships, or finances.
